Understanding Porcelain Tile
Before we dive into the specifics of matte porcelain tile, let's first understand what porcelain tile is. Porcelain tile is a type of ceramic tile made from finely ground sand, clay, and other minerals that are fired at extremely high temperatures. This process results in a dense, non-porous, and durable material that is highly resistant to moisture, stains, and scratches.

The Distinction of Matte Finish
Matte porcelain tile differentiates itself from its counterparts through its unique finish. Unlike glossy or polished tiles that reflect light, matte tiles have a low-luster or non-reflective surface. This is achieved through a specific manufacturing process that involves applying a special glaze or sandblasting the tile's surface.

Benefits of Matte Porcelain Tile
Easy to Clean and Maintain: The non-porous and non-reflective surface of matte porcelain tile makes it resistant to dirt, stains, and fingerprints. Cleaning is a breeze, requiring minimal effort and no special cleaning products.
Durability: Matte porcelain tile is highly durable and resistant to wear and tear, making it an excellent choice for high-traffic are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, and entryways.
Versatility in Design: Matte porcelain tile comes in a wide range of colors, patterns, and textures, allowing for a multitude of design possibilities. It can mimic the look of natural stone, wood, or concrete, offering a unique blend of style and functionality.
Safety and Comfort: Matte surfaces provide better traction than glossy or polished surfaces, making them safer for areas prone to moisture, such as bathrooms and kitchens.
Heat and Frost Resistance: Porcelain tile, including matte varieties, is highly resistant to heat and frost,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ications.

Installation and Care Tips

Installing and caring for matte porcelain tile is relatively straightforward. Here are some tips:
Use a flexible, thinset mortar for installation to account for any slight movement in the substrate.
Allow the tile to acclimate to the room's temperature and humidity before installation.
Clean any spills promptly to prevent staining.
Use a soft, damp cloth and mild soap for routine cleaning.
Avoid using abrasive materials or harsh chemicals that could scratch or damage the tile's surface.
